BANARAS THROUGH A LENS

BETWEEN FIRE AND WATER

Explore Banaras beyond the postcard through its ghats, old galis, markets, food, weaving neighbourhoods, rituals, and everyday life.

Learn phone photography and videography through simple visual prompts, observation, framing, sound, and storytelling. No prior experience needed.

See the city through its contrasts, where faith and routine, life and death, chaos and stillness, the sacred and the everyday often exist side by side.

Spend time with local communities, artisans, weavers, vendors, and others who shape the city, learning through their work, routines, traditions, and lived knowledge.

Come together through daily visual reflections to discuss, observe, edit, and gradually shape your own interpretation of the Banaras you experienced.
